We demonstrate the self-assembly, characterization, and bioelectrocatalysis of redox-active cyclodextrin-coated nanoparticles. The nanoparticles with host-guest functionality are easy to assemble and permit entrapment of hydrophobic redox mols. in aqueous solution Bis-pyrene-ABTS encapsulated nanoparticles were investigated electrochem. and spectroscopically. Their use as electron shuttles was demonstrated via an intra-electron transfer chain between neighboring redox units of clustered particles (Dh,DLS = 195 nm) and the mono- and trinuclear Cu sites of bilirubin oxidases. Enhanced current densities for mediated O2 reduction were observed with the redox nanoparticle system compared to equivalent bioelectrode cells with a dissolved mediator. Improved catalytic stability over 2 days was also observed with the redox nanoparticles, highlighting a stabilizing effect of the polymeric architecture. Bioinspired nanoparticles as mediators for bioelectrocatalysis promises to be valuable for future biofuel cells and biosensors.
